Old Head of Kinsale
This remarkable course has featured in many if not all of
the golfing guides to Ireland. It is a truly remarkable experience,
perched on an old headland, some 200-foot above the sea, with
breathtaking views on all sides. Quite simply it is a must
for the serious golfer or anyone wishing to try something
quite different.
Liselane Golf Course
More down-to-earth, this is a lovely course set in the middle
of the Liselane estate and racing stables. Although just 9
holes long, it is testing and demanding, with beautiful scenery
alongside the river Argideen as it meanders through the famous
gardens. Liselane is just outside Clonakilty on the Main N
71 to Bandon.

Walking
Walking is a popular pastime and there is plenty of it just
outside the driveway of the house. We supply Ordnance Survey
maps so that guests do not get horribly lost.
Locally, there are some lovely walks from the house to Broad
Strand, a super sandy beach just about 1 mile in distance.
Blind Strand and Barry's Cove, an old smugglers haunt, are
also easily accessed.
In
the other direction there are walks out to Travara, at the
end of The Seven Heads Peninsula, or through the lanes to
yet more sandy coves and beaches, the principal one being
Dunworley, and next door Maloney's.
Just down the road by car, there is also a coastal walk of
around 5 hours that starts in Courtmacsherry and finishes
at Travara. The walk passes through some superb coastal scenery,
really wild stuff, if one keeps an eye out for wildlife there
are plenty of birds of every description, seals and an occasional
sea otter. It passes at the back of some of the highest sea
cliffs in West Cork called the Coolim Cliffs.

River Fishing: Salmon and sea trout are to be caught on the
River Bandon, just 20 min away.
The River Argadine is a famous sea trout river just 10 min
from the house.
You will need a Salmon Licence and Permission to Fish licence
for any river fishing, however if you just fish for trout you
can delete the Salmon Licence.
